abstract = {Experimental results on waveguide-plasma coupling and
rf heating in the vicinity of the lower-hybrid
frequency in the M.I.T. Alcator-A and in Versator II
tokamaks are reported. The forthcoming Alcator-C
lower-hybrid heating experimental parameters are
summarized. From Princeton results on several
small-scale experiments, related to waveguide-plasma
coupling (H-1) and rf current drive (ACT-l), are
presented, as well as recent theoretical
investigations of efficient rf current generation
using lower-hybrid waves or Alfvén waves.}
